I performed a Booster PCB swap to my Zip and the steering does not properly work. The right steering turns left for some reason but the left turns left. Could anyone help and provide a picture of a Bit PCB in a Zip?

there should be 2 wires from the steering coils marked black or something. they go together on the v+ pad. the other 2 should go to the l and r pads, swap them if your steering is reversed.

a quick fix should be to swap the position of the 2 wires coming from the left coil.
